What they do

A Business Change Manager designs and implements strategies that facilitate smooth transition during organizational changes within workplaces. Responsibilities include identifying risks of change, developing training plans, monitoring progresses and implementing improvements to change plans. They may work with key stakeholders and project managers to ensure changes align with corporate strategic objectives.
